The difference between the buying price and the selling price of a share is referred to as
A
Commission
B
Profit
C
Jobber's Profit
D
Turnover
Ask EduPadi AI for a detailed answer
Correct Option: C
The difference between the price at which a former jobber on the London Stock Exchange was prepared to buy and the price at which the jobber was prepared to sell. See also spread. From: jobber's turn in A Dictionary of Finance and Banking »
